It’s hard to describe. Not like a total drooler, I’m playing tight aggressive and haven’t shown my cards yet, but I’m 40ish a little overweight white guy who looks like he’s late for a tee time. This is, sad to say, usually a visual that aligns with less than stellar play.

I fold there (in theory, in reality I convince myself to call in a lot of clear fold situations) because in general I don’t expect standard “pros” to waste too much time running big bluffs against overweight white guys who look like they are late for a tee time.
It might be wrong but it’s probably profitable long term.

We’re expecting her to try and bluff you off exactly what you have (TT-KK) which is going to be a very -ev play long term on her part.

The reason your hand doesn’t look like AK is routinely cbetting in position when you have ace high is terrible.
